Itinerary
Day 1 Meet in San Jose and get acquainted over dinner with your travel companions and guides.

Day 2 Travel in our luxury coach through the Braulio Carrillo National Park and get your first introduction to Costa Rica’s rainforests with a short hike in the park. Spend the afternoon relaxing or choosing from a variety of activities, including:
• Stroll through extensive gardens of native tropical plants
• Experience the mysterious complexities of the rainforest with an easy self-guided hike on an island lush with tropical vegetation.
• Visit a museum featuring rainforest ecology and indigenous and pre-Hispanic history

Day 3 Participate in a half-day walk with one of the excellent naturalist guides at a Biological Reseach Station; explore the wildlife in a boat tour on the Sarapiqui River or take an easy rainforest rafting trip on the Upper Sarapiqui river.

Day 4 Begin the day with a naturalist’s garden walk featuring historical, medicinal and edible plants.
Tour to LaPaz Waterfall Gardens with lunch; dinner and shopping in the lively town of Fortuna

Day 5 Choose from several exciting actitivites in the Arenal Volcano area such as a canopy zip line tour, a waterfall hike; end the day at the fabulous Tabacon Hot Springs with dinner.

Day 6 Today our group will take a small boat ride across the scenic Lake Arenal providing a panoramic view of the volcano. We are met by our drivers and continue the trip over the mountain to the town of Santa Elena, home of the Monteverde Cloud Forest Reserve; after lunch we are met by a naturalist for a guided nature hike in the cloud forest.

Day 7 Today we will spend the day experiencing the uniqueness of the Monteverde area; activities may include a tour of the quaint village settled by Quakers, including the cheese factory and numerous artist’s galleries; the exciting SkyTrek Canopy Tour. Dinner in Santa Elena.

Day 8 Return to San Jose for your flight home. If time allows, we will stop in the small village of Sarchi, the cradle of wood crafting and decorating in Costa Rica, particularly known for its production of colorful ox-carts and the famous leather rocking chairs.
